Instructions to make Beef Braciole:
First, prepare the filling by combining all ingredients and mixing well with your hands. It should be somewhat pasty and sticking together.
Next, lay out the 6 pieces of beef and put a slice of mozzarella in the center of each piece. Top the mozzarella with 1/6 of the prepared filling.
Roll up the steak longways and secure with a toothpick.
Place the rolled-up steaks in a baking dish and cover with tomato sauce and more Parmesan cheese, if desired.
Cover with aluminium foil and bake in a 350 degree oven for about 45 minutes.
Prepare pasta according to package directions.
Remove braciole to a serving dish and use the remaining tomato sauce for the pasta.
